The guy who is quoting to put the TV system into our place in Portugal (we need UK, German, Portuguese and Dutch channels) Has recommended a Humax Foxsat HD receiver. Amazon have them for £120 with free delivery to Portugal. They seem to have some nice lock-down features, which is important if we are going to have guests using it. Humax seem to have a good reputation bt I do need something that is fairly idiot proof. Has anyone any views on this?

 

I appreciate we won't get the foreign channels. I did look at putting two offset LNBs on the big dish but Astra 2 reception can drop out when it's raining, so I don't want to risk making it worse. We are going to have a separate 80cm dish and receiver for Astra 1.

This is a great box I have the PVR version myself and have been really pleased with it.

The EPG however is going to be a bit messy for you I think, the box has two modes Freesat and Non-Freesat.

The tuning is selected based on your initial setup preferences such as Country and Postcode.

 

The reciever is slightly deaf in that i cant get a decent lock on some of the channels with a 60cm Sky Dish. I think you are going to need a 1.2m dish with a very low noise LNB to pull in BBC and ITV in all weather conditions.

 

You might be better off with one of the more generalised HD Sat Boxes that is more Euro Friendly as the Humax does seem to localise everything quite well especially if you want a wider choice of channels.

My Humax has dual tuners and a pass thru so you could easily stack it with a different box one for UK specific reception and another for Euro Channels.

 

Your better off spending you money on a good quality Dish/LNB package as Tuners are cheap as chips and obsolete it seems in a matter of months... you can then change your STB as often as your shorts :)

The Humax will be used with the 130cm dish for freesat. The 80cm dish will go to a receiver I will buy in Portugal for the European channels. As I understand it, the only way you can get access to Astra 1 and Astra 2 from one dish, is to use two offset LNBs. I assume that the signal hiting the LNBs is going to be weaker if they are offset and as the Astra 1 signal is pretty weak in Southern Portugal anyway and an 80cm dish costs peanuts, I figured separate dishes is the way to go.

 

Presumably pass-through is taking the feed from the LNB through one receiver and then into the other one, which would only work if I was planning to access one satellite.
